+ # @kavachos/dashboard
2
+
3
+ Admin UI for managing agents, permissions, and audit logs.
4
+
5
+ [![npm](https://img.shields.io/npm/v/@kavachos/dashboard)](https://www.npmjs.com/package/@kavachos/dashboard)
6
+
7
+ ## Install
8
+
9
+ ```bash
10
+ npm install @kavachos/dashboard
11
+ ```
12
+
13
+ Peer dependencies: React 19+
14
+
15
+ ## Usage
16
+
17
+ ### Embedded component
18
+
19
+ Mount the dashboard inside your existing React app:
20
+
21
+ ```tsx
22
+ import { KavachDashboard } from "@kavachos/dashboard";
23
+
24
+ export function AdminPage() {
25
+ return (
26
+ <KavachDashboard
27
+ apiUrl="http://localhost:3000"
28
+ />
29
+ );
30
+ }
31
+ ```
32
+
33
+ The component connects to your KavachOS API and renders the full admin interface, including agent management, permission inspection, and audit log queries.
34
+
35
+ ### Standalone server
36
+
37
+ Run the dashboard without a React app using the CLI:
38
+
39
+ ```bash
40
+ npx kavachos dashboard
41
+ # Starts on http://localhost:3100
42
+
43
+ npx kavachos dashboard --port 4000 --api http://localhost:3000
44
+ ```
45
+
46
+ This starts a Hono server that serves the dashboard UI and proxies API requests to your KavachOS backend.
47
+
48
+ ## Options
49
+
50
+ | Prop / Flag | Default | Description |
51
+ |---|---|---|
52
+ | `apiUrl` / `--api` | `http://localhost:3000` | URL of your KavachOS API |
53
+ | `--port` | `3100` | Port for the standalone server |
